Est 1993, The Brooker's Farm Beautiful farmland with gorgeous view of the mountains. Come visit us at our Isolated farm land and get away from it all... Distant from the city lights, enjoy a night beneath the stars, feel the cool breeze and the sounds of nature as you relax. Minutes from local breweries, a cider orchard and many great restaurants! Easy access to I-25, Denver, Boulder, Loveland, Estes Park and other Colorado Front Range Locations. Beautiful view of the Rocky Mountains, and a great place to relax! Sometimes just sitting back, taking in the views and relaxing is all it takes to decompress from the hustle and bustle of daily life. The terrain is basically a flat field layout, fairly soft and sandy. We do mow the weeds weekly to keep everything in order and maintain a safe and easy to get around campground. Stretch your legs and unwind, we have plenty of room for pets to roam and play. We do recommend keeping them on a leash when possible to avoid conflict with other Hip campers that may have dogs. Walk up to the corral and visit our goats and Alpaca, they love attention and will eat all the weeds you can pull and feed to them. Dante is the Alpaca's name, Leonard and Sheldon are the energetic, crazy fun loving goats. There are also ducks free-roaming and quacking around the farm if you happen to see them. There are fire-pits around the sites, please feel free to grab one and use it. We have firewood for sale for $5 per bundle if needed. ALL SITES have great cell service (Tmobile, AT&T, Verizon & others) and free WIFI. TV reception is pretty good if you point your antenna to Lookout Mountain for all the digital channels, WiFi is great and can be used anywhere on the property. Fresh, clean & cold well water available at the front of the farmhouse and a clean, well lighted porta-potty available for campers east of the big red barn. No sewer, RV dump or electric available onsite. Trash dumpster is located at the front of the property by the road. Generators are welcome, just please be considerate of your neighbors. Quiet time is from 10 PM to 6AM Daily. We have a small supply of camping necessities, a 'virtual camp store' if you will. You forgot a toothbrush, need shampoo, a can opener, need some tin foil, or any of the basic necessities, we most likely have it free of charge. We will deliver it right out to you at your campsite. Local destinations: Denver 32 miles, Boulder 26 miles, Estes park 44 miles, Fort Collins 39 miles, Central City 61 miles, Longmont 7 miles. Notice: Per Colorado state law there is a 14 day maximum stay allowed per any 30 day period. This may be 14 consecutive days or 14 days spread throughout the 30 days. We DO NOT offer long term or permanent camping.
